1. Soy Sauce Steamed Tilapia

Preparation
40 minutes
Difficulty
Easy
Ingredients for Soy Sauce Steamed Tilapia Serves 4
Tilapia 1 fish Dill 100 gr Green onions a bit Peppercorn 5 teaspoons (ground) Lemongrass 6 stalks Chili 6 pieces Ginger 1 piece Soy sauce 5 tablespoons Fish sauce 2 tablespoons
How to prepare Steamed Tilapia with Soy Sauce
-
Prepare the tilapia
Clean the tilapia by removing the scales, belly, and slime. Then, use a knife to make diagonal cuts on both sides of the fish to help the seasoning penetrate quickly and the fish cook faster.
-
Prepare other ingredients
Wash the dill and green onions, then cut them into pieces about 1 finger length.
Smash and mince the ginger. Wash and chop the chili.
Wash the lemongrass, take the root part, smash it, and finely chop it.
-
Add seasoning to the fish
After preparing the tilapia, marinate it with a mixture of spices: minced ginger, chopped dill, chopped chili, and minced ginger.
Rub the spices all over the fish, then add 2 teaspoons of ground pepper, 5 tablespoons of soy sauce, and 2 tablespoons of fish sauce, and continue to rub until the spices are evenly distributed on the fish.
Stuff the chopped dill and green onions into the fish’s belly while rubbing the spices.
Do the same with the rest of the fish. Marinate everything for 15 – 20 minutes.
-
Steamed Fish
After marinating, place the fish in a pot and start steaming. Once the fish is cooked, the dish emits a delicious aroma from the soy sauce, indicating that the dish is ready.
Tip: During steaming, you can add a little soy sauce to enhance the flavor of the dish. -
Final Product
The steamed tilapia with soy sauce has a fragrant aroma, tender and sweet fish, along with the combination of familiar ingredients creating a unique appeal for the dish. This steamed fish goes well with rice or rolled with herbs and noodles. Wish you success!
2. Beer Steamed Tilapia

Preparation
40 minutes
Difficulty
Easy
Ingredients for Beer Steamed Tilapia Serves 3
Tilapia 1 fish Beer 100 ml Dill A little Lemongrass 6 stalks Galangal 2 rhizomes Ginger 1 piece Red onion 2 bulbs Chili 4 fruits Raw tamarind 1 fruit Pepper A little MSG 1 teaspoon
How to cook beer steamed tilapia
-
Prepare the tilapia
Clean the tilapia by removing the scales, belly, and slime. Then, use a knife to make cuts on both sides of the fish to help the seasoning absorb quickly and the fish cook faster.
-
Prepare the other ingredients
Dill should be washed clean and cut into pieces about the length of a finger.
Ginger should be smashed and minced. Chili should be washed clean and chopped small. Shallot should be chopped small.
Lemongrass should be washed clean, take the root part, smash it, and chop small. Keep the remaining part of the lemongrass to steam the fish.
Galangal should be washed clean and minced.
-
Season the fish
Marinate the fish with the prepared ingredients including: minced lemongrass keeping the upper part, chopped chili, minced galangal, finely chopped shallots, 1 piece of tamarind split in half, minced ginger, and finely chopped dill.
Then, add 100ml of beer and mix all the spices well and rub them into the fish for quicker absorption. Marinate the fish for about 15 minutes.
-
Steam the fish
After 15 minutes of marinating the fish, we place the fish in a pot and steam until the fish is cooked and ready to serve.
-
Final Product
This steamed tilapia with beer dish is unique as it uses beer for steaming, resulting in soft fish that absorbs the spices just right. This dish pairs very well with rice, is not greasy, and is very nutritious. Wish you success!
How to choose fresh and delicious tilapia
- You should choose male tilapia with a round body, weighing about 1.5kg – 2kg, as it will have more meat, firm and fatty flesh, suitable for steaming.
- If you are going to braise the fish, you may consider buying female fish, which have a big belly containing a lot of eggs and will be fatter.
- The gills of the fish should be bright red and not bruised. If the fish has no unpleasant smell, it is good tilapia.
How to clean tilapia properly, without a fishy smell
- Step 1: Wash the tilapia thoroughly 2 – 3 times with clean water.
- Step 2: Clean the inside of the fish’s belly, remove the gills, and thoroughly clean the bile and intestines.
- Step 3: Use a knife to cut off the fins and scrape off the scales of the fish.
- Step 4: Use a little salt (or lemon) to rub the body and belly of the fish clean.
- Step 5: Soak the fish in saltwater (you can add some vinegar or a little alcohol).
- Step 6: Rinse the fish 2 – 3 times and then let it drain.
